T. For me it was a brief from Foundation 33 – resulting in the ‘Spair’. In response to the requirements of open plan living, the Spair is a flat packed chair that sits on the wall as a graphic or tableau. When needed, the lightweight piece can be taken down and unfolded into a spare chair. I felt this encompassed all aspects of my design process, thoroughly worked through to completion. But it was also coming to terms with my working method – that my objects develop through a series of experiments rather than sketches. Still to this day I’d much rather work through a 3D programme than in a sketch book.
